Storage in San Diego runs $150 to $350 per month for a vault holding a typical 1-bedroom and $300 to $700 for a 3-bedroom load, with month-to-month terms after a 30-day minimum. Climate-controlled space holds steady at 65 to 75 degrees and 50 percent humidity for art, electronics, leather, and wood furniture.

Why are East County San Diego moving storage different?

East County storage is heavy on senior-downsizing transitions where the family hasn't sorted estate contents yet and needs 60-180 days to make decisions. Climate-controlled units are critical because El Cajon and Lakeside summer storage uncontrolled sees 115°F interior temps that warp anything wood-veneered. Hard-water residue on appliances coming into storage gets a wipe-down so corrosion doesn't spread. The movers we connect you with pick up directly, no double-handling. What's included with moving storage in Lakeside?

  • Climate-controlled vaults (65-75°F, ~50% RH) for furniture, art, electronics, leather, wood
  • Ambient warehouse for boxed household goods and non-sensitive items
  • In-transit storage between move-out and move-in dates (typical 1-30 day window)
  • Long-term storage with month-to-month billing after the 30-day minimum
  • Vault storage (5x7x7 wooden crates, ~250 cubic feet) or full-truck storage for larger loads
  • Inventory list and photo log of every vault on intake

When does a Lakeside home need moving storage?

  • Your move-out date is before your move-in date
  • You're downsizing and need a holding place while you decide
  • You're staging a home for sale and need furniture out for 60 to 90 days
  • You're deploying or PCSing and need a place for goods you cannot ship
  • Your new place is being renovated and you need 30 to 180 days of holding

Do I need climate-controlled storage in San Diego?

Coastal San Diego doesn't get extreme temperatures, but humidity swings and salt air do real damage to leather, electronics, art, and certain woods over months. For storage under 60 days, ambient is usually fine. Past 60 days or for sensitive items at any duration, climate-controlled is the safer call. The price difference is about $40 to $80 per month for a 1-bedroom load.

How does the 30-day minimum work?

Storage is billed in 30-day increments. If you store for 5 days, you still pay for 30. After the first 30, billing prorates daily so you only pay for the days your goods are in the vault. There's no annual contract: month-to-month after the minimum.
